Problem 1:
The table below includes a training data set, containing the record ID and the inputs: Age, Income, Student, and Credit Rating, in addition to the target variable: Buys Computer. Using the first 10 records and Nave Bayes algorithm, classify the 11th record. Your computations are done by hand. You may refer to the PowerPoint pertaining to Nave Bayes algorithm.
Record ID Age Income Student Credit Rating Buys Computer
1 Youth High No Fair No
2 Youth High No Excellent No
3 Middle Aged High No Fair Yes
4 Senior Medium No Fair Yes
5 Senior Low Yes Fair Yes
6 Senior Low Yes Excellent No
7 Middle Aged Low Yes Excellent Yes
8 Youth Medium No Fair No
9 Youth Low Yes Fair Yes
10 Senior Medium Yes Fair Yes
11 Youth Medium Yes Excellent ?
Problem 2:
Use the first 10 records of the table above and C&RT algorithm to find the optimal split that will be used for the root node. Computations are done by hand. You may refer to the PowerPoint pertaining to CART.
